Which lab value is most indicative of renal function?

Explanation:
Serum creatinine levels are the most indicative of renal function because creatinine is a waste product produced from muscle metabolism that is filtered out of the blood by the kidneys. A healthy kidney effectively removes creatinine, so an elevation in serum creatinine levels often indicates impaired kidney function. In renal impairment, the kidneys are unable to filter out creatinine at a normal rate, resulting in increased levels in the blood. This relationship makes serum creatinine a sensitive marker for kidney health, particularly in the setting of acute or chronic kidney disease. While blood urea nitrogen (BUN) levels can also provide information about kidney function, they can be influenced by factors such as protein intake, dehydration, and liver function, making them less specific to renal function than serum creatinine. Electrolyte levels can reveal imbalances that may occur due to kidney dysfunction but do not directly measure renal function. Urinalysis can provide valuable information regarding the state of the kidneys and the urinary tract, but it does not offer a specific measure of overall renal function as serum creatinine does. Thus, serum creatinine levels are the most direct indicator of renal health and efficiency.
